When and where was Alpha Kappa Alpha Sorority founded? 1908. Howard University.Washington, D.C.

Why was Alpha Kappa Alpha founded? To make college experiences meaningful and valuable by enhancing the capacity of college-trained women for significant self-realization

Who was the moving spirit in the establishment of Alpha Kappa Alpha, and by whom was she influenced? Ethel Hedgemen Lyle; Tremain Robinson and Elizabeth Appa Cook (school teachers)

How are chapter program activities determined? By the International Program Committee, as defined by the Supreme Basileus

How many individuals were in the original group? Nine; Anna Easter Brown, Beulah Burke, Lillie Burke, Marjorie Hill, Margaret Flagg Holmes, Ethel Hedgeman (Lyle), Lavinia Norman, Lucy Diggs Slowe and Marie Woolfolk (Taylor)

Who was elected as the first president? Lucy Diggs Slowe

Who are the seven (7) Sophomores who were admitted into the sorority without initiation in 1928? The Seven (7) Sophomores: Norma Boyd, Ethel Jones (Mowbray), Alice Murray, Sarah Meriweather (Nutter), Joanna Berry (Shields), Carrie Snowden and Harriet Terry

"Ivy Beyond the Wall" meaning Deceased soror

January 15, 1908 AKA was founded

January 29, 1913 AKA was incorporated

Programs for Graduate Members Fellowships, financial aid, job placement

When and where was the first international chapter set up? 1948 in Libera

When was the first national office opened? October 8, 1949

Cleveland Job Corps Center 1965: First woman's organization to have opportunity to assisted the government in preparing women and girls for the responsibilities of citizenship through an anti-poverty program.

Heritage Series on Black Women 1968: A series of brochures detailing the accomplishments of Black women. 1 / 2

Domestic Travel Tour 1969: One week tour of cities with sites, significant to Black heritage.

AKA Connection A Communication Network.

Leadership Fellows Program Two-phase development program for undergraduates designed to improve their leadership skills via structured theoretical exposure and pragmatic training.

Where is the sorority's Corporate Office? 5656 South Stony Island Avenue, Chicago, IL 60637

773-684-1282

Corporate Office's Chief Adminstrator Executive Director; Maintains permanent records, transacts business, implements AKA programs.

Chapter president and role Presides at all meetings of the chapter, appoints members of committees, and serves as an ex-officio member of all committees.

Greek word for President Basileus

Greek word for Vice-President Anti-Basileus

Greek word for Secretary Grammateus

Greek word for Assistant Secretary Anti-Grammateus

Greek word for Treasurer Tamiouchos

Greek word for Financial Secretary Pecunious Grammateus

Greek word for Hostess Hodegos

Greek word for Sergeant-at-Arms Phliacter

Sorority A society for women with selective membership limited by the invitation of persons who are already members.

Boule The periodic assembly of the total membership.
